Cole: Ninja of Earth is a Ninjago book released in 2012.

Plot[]
Intro[]
The ninja are telling Master Wu about how they got the Nunchucks of Lightning. All the ninja helped in different ways to get them, with Cole just leading the group. Wu says that the best hero is the one who lets others be heroes.
Main Plot[]
The ninja all ignore Cole's plan for fighting a group of skulkin and everything goes wrong. The next morning, the ninja discuss choosing a new leader instead of Cole. The next morning, the ninja have been robbed. They find Cole unconscious and a note from the "Phantom ninja", who Cole says was an old enemy of Wu. Cole refuses to lead the group. Each ninja uses their skills to follow clues from the Phantom Ninja. Eventually, they discover that the Phantom Ninja is Cole, who was trying to teach the ninja that they must appreciate each other's skills. Then the real Phantom Ninja fights and defeats them all with ease. Eventually, the ninja follow Cole's plan and defeat the Phantom Ninja, who tells them he was not enemies with Wu, but was a bandit who Wu converted. The Phantom Ninja was trying to give the ninja a common enemy.
Trivia[]
- The Intro explains what happened before King of Shadows’ short scene in the Floating Ruins.
- The main story is set after the ninja learn Spinjitzu and before Samukai is killed and before Wu goes to the Underworld. This only works either between the first and second weapon or between the second and third weapon as several nights pass but only one passes between the third weapon and Wu's departure.
- This book marks the first and only appearance of the Phantom Ninja, though another character of the same title would later be introduced.
- Like the other books, this story can be considered canon unless the series contradicts it at some point.[2] When asked whether this book in particular is canon, Tommy Andreasen responded, "Not sure! But there nothing in it that contradicts the main story."[3]
